Electrochemical hydro- and seleno-amination of 2,3-dihydrofurans

Abstract

An electrochemical hydro- and seleno-amination of 2,3-dihydrofurans is reported herein, enabling efficient access to tetrahydrofuran-based hemiaminal ether derivatives. Furthermore, this electrochemical strategy is successfully applied for the synthesis of 2-selenonucleoside analogues.
